Transaction ea14ce28f154a18a955596b2bfc3ce8ef38c9c8af06a6cb9d5d145655648de5a
1 Input
1 Output
-
ea14ce28f154a18a955596b2bfc3ce8ef38c9c8af06a6cb9d5d145655648de5a:0
- value
- 355749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a282a147fb574fc66111af279850f405499f35d OP_EQUAL
- address
- 3CpvUcj7ZhUZX27EXZWBUaDag5Yfgpf2mW